Understanding Equine Hydration Needs


A horse's water requirement can vary depending on several factors, including its size, diet, workload, and environmental conditions. On average, a horse needs about 5 to 10 gallons of water per day. However, during hot weather or periods of intense exercise, this requirement can significantly increase.


Signs of Dehydration in Horses


Identifying dehydration early is crucial. Signs include:

  • Dry mucous membranes
  • Sunken eyes
  • Dull coat
  • Decreased skin elasticity (perform a skin pinch test)
  • Reduced urine output

Recognising these symptoms early can help prevent severe health issues.


Strategies to Encourage Water Consumption


Provide Clean, Fresh Water

The most fundamental step is to ensure your horse always has access to clean, fresh water. Regularly cleaning water troughs and buckets to prevent algae and debris buildup is essential. Studies have shown that horses are more likely to drink water that is cool and fresh, especially during the hotter months.


Flavouring the Water

Electrolyte Supplementation

Electrolytes play a crucial role in maintaining fluid balance and encouraging drinking. During the summer, horses lose more electrolytes through sweat. Salt Blocks and Mineral Licks

Providing free access to salt blocks or mineral licks can naturally encourage horses to drink more water. Salt increases thirst, prompting more frequent drinking. Ensure the salt block is always available in the horse's feeding area.


Wetting the Feed

Another effective method is to wet the horse's feed. Mixing water into their grain or hay can increase their overall water intake. Be cautious not to make the feed too soggy, as it might deter them from eating.


Regular Monitoring and Adjustments

Monitor your horse's water intake daily. Using a water meter can help track consumption accurately. If you notice a decline in water intake, investigate potential causes such as changes in diet, stress, or health issues.


Additional Tips for Optimal Hydration


Providing Multiple Water Sources

In larger pastures or turnout areas, providing multiple water sources can encourage more frequent drinking. Horses may be more inclined to drink if water is readily accessible in various locations.


Shade and Shelter

Offering shade and shelter can prevent overheating, reducing the likelihood of dehydration. Horses that are cooler are less stressed and more likely to drink adequately.


Travel Considerations

When travelling, bring along water from home, as some horses are picky about the taste of unfamiliar water. Portable water containers and collapsible buckets can make this process easier.
